Summary

In the past 3 years, the District of Arbon has seen its population grow by 3.87%, to 59,669.

Demographics

On average, people earn CHF 68,120 annually.

10.28% of the population are university graduates, 15.45% have a higher vocational education qualification, 50.49% have an SEK II qualification (school-leaving certificate or apprenticeship) and 23.78% are currently completing compulsory education.

The residential area is prestigious thanks to its high social standards and educated population.

At present, 1.26% of the population is unemployed.

Taxes

The tax rate for the area is 11.42%. It differs from person to person and depends on aspects including current income, marital status and the total amount of deductions.

In the District of Arbon, for instance, a married couple on a pension (over 65) pays an average of 14.56% tax, a couple with two children 7.75% and a childless couple 10.72%%. The tax percentage for a childless, unmarried person is 15.76%.

The property market in general

New builds

The District of Arbon has recorded an increase of 2,117 new apartments within the last 5 years.

33 of the new apartments are 1-room apartments, which are ideal for people living alone.

There are also a total of 348 new 2-room apartments.

In addition, 674 3-room apartments and 627 4-room apartments have been added to the pool of housing available locally in recent years.

The number of new apartments amounts to 283 5-room apartments and 152 apartments with a minimum of 6 rooms.

Housing stock

New construction has further expanded the supply of housing in the region; there are now a total of 30,585 apartments in the District of Arbon.

The number of 1-room apartments totals 1,067.

Additionally, there are 3,270 apartments with 2 rooms, 7,434 apartments with 3 rooms and 9,764 apartments with 4 rooms.

A total of 5,132 5-room apartments and 3,918 spacious apartments with a minimum of 6 rooms are also available in the region.

Empty apartments

1.92% of apartments in the District of Arbon are vacant.

Of this figure, 3.76% of 1-room apartments,

2.82% of all apartments with 2 rooms,

2.58% of 3-room apartments,

1.98% of the apartments with 4 rooms

and 0.96% of apartments with 5 rooms are currently uninhabited.

The rate of vacancy is 0.79% for apartments with more than 5 rooms and 0.56% for apartments with more than 6 rooms.

Property market (rental only)

Rental properties are offered for prices averaging around CHF 1,358 per month.

Consequently, 25% of all rents on the market are cheaper than or equal to a monthly rent of CHF 1,140 (25th percentile).

And 75% of monthly rents are less than or equivalent to CHF 1,600 (75th percentile).
